WebMoisturise your hands regularly at work with Dermol 500 or another moisturiser, e.g. Cetraben or Diprobase. Your manager should be able to provide this for you. Use a greasier emollient after your shift and at home, e.g. Hydromol, Epaderm or emulsifying ointment. WebJun 5, 2024 · Depending on the severity of your signs and symptoms, treatment options may include: Corticosteroids. High-potency corticosteroid creams and ointments may help speed the disappearance of the blisters. Wrapping the treated area in plastic wrap can improve absorption.
